There are, however, scenarios where the user wants to create, for example, a list inside a table cell and then the support for block content is necessary. In such a scenario, printing out elements would be semantically incorrect and also unnecessary. in the demo above) and it is common for “data tables” to not contain any block content. ![]() The reason for this differentiation is that most tables contain only inline content (e.g. This means that a table cell can have two states: with inline content or with block content. However, if a table cell contains just one paragraph and this paragraph has no special attributes (like text alignment), the cell content is considered “inline” and the paragraph is not rendered. These would typically include add or remove columns and rows and merge or split cells. The toolbar appears when a table or a cell is selected and contains various table-related buttons.
